Isolation and characterisation of receptors that are bound by members of the BT-toxin family of insecticidal proteins with respect to pesticides and pest resistance

摘要

The cDNA encoding a glycoprotein receptor from the tobacco hornworm (Manduca sexta) that binds a Bacillus thuringiensis (BT) toxin has been obtained and sequenced. The availability of this cDNA permits the retrieval of DNAs encoding homologous receptors in other insects and organisms as well as the design of assays for the cytotoxicity and binding affinity of potential pesticides and the development of methods to manipulate natural and/or introduced homologous receptors and thus, to destroy target cells, tissues and/or organisms. The isolation and characterisation of a receptor that is bound by members of the BT-toxin family of insecticidal proteins (BT-R1 protein) and a gene encoding the BT-toxin receptor are described. Compositions and methods for use in identifying agents that bind to the BT-R1 protein as a means for identifying insecticidal agents and for identifying other members of the BT-R1 family are also described.
